Hollywood Supergroup comes to Essex town

American rock supergroup Hollywood Vampires featuring Alice Cooper, Johnny Depp, Joe Perry and Tommy Henriksen return to the UK this summer as part of their hugely anticipated UK tour, marking their first live shows in almost three years.

It’s been a decade since Hollywood Vampires first came together — and they’re still raising hell on stage. Formed in 2015, the band bonded over a shared love of their favourite songs and a desire to celebrate their ‘dead, drunk friends’ by playing the music of rock’s fallen heroes. Named after Alice Cooper’s 1970s drinking club, which included the likes of John Lennon, Keith Moon and Mickey Dolenz, Hollywood Vampires quickly earned a reputation for blistering live shows – a riotous mix of original anthems and tributes to the legends who inspired them.

Their sets are a raucous celebration of rock’s greatest icons, performed alongside their own powerhouse material. Hollywood Vampires’ shows feature stone-cold classics from The Who, Led Zeppelin, David Bowie, Motörhead, The Doors, AC/DC and more, alongside hits from Alice Cooper and Aerosmith. The Damned are supporting Hollywood Vampires with 12 studio albums – including the era-defining Damned Damned Damned – and several UK chart singles under their belts, the legends mark their 50th anniversary with a new tour and album. Released on Friday January 23, Not Like Everybody Else is a deeply personal and celebratory covers album dedicated to the memory of Brian James, the bands legendary founding guitarist who died in 2025.
